Acanthoderes (Scythropopsis) virescens ( Fuchs, 1962) View in CoL transfer

Fig. 1

Acanthoderes (Psapharochrus) virescens Fuchs, 1962: 323 View in CoL . Psapharochrus virescens View in CoL ; Monné, 2005: 214 (catalogue).

The flattened tibiae and the antennae shorter than the body in both sexes are the most remarkable characters of the subgenus Scythropopsis Thomson, 1864 View in CoL . The transfer is proposed based upon examination of the photograph of the female paratype (CHSV) and two specimens from MNRJ.

Acanthoderes (Psapharochrus) virescens is very similar in colour and structure to Acanthoderes (Scythropopsis) albitarsis Laporte, 1840 , largely distributed in east and south Brazil.

Specimens examined. PERU, Huánuco: Rio Huallaga, female, I.1985 (L. Peña) (MNRJ). Junin: Chanchamayo, female (MNRJ).

Geographical distribution. Peru.
